Genuine Creation Meets Inspiration
Every fragrance creation is a product of a special formulation of natural wonders. Perfume oils are extracted from flowers, fruits, herbs, spices, and coppices considered as exotic in the wild. In general, these are classified as floral for flowery fragrance, fruity for sweet tang, oriental for spicy dash, woody for natural whiff, and foody for appetizing tinge. In turn, juices are blended in a unique way to produce a distinctive scent close to the original inspiration of the perfumer.
Take Note of these Aromatic Notes
These scent oils represent each of the three prime aromatic elements such as the top note, heart note, and base note. The top note brings out the initial impression but easily goes out after some time giving way to the heart note regarded as the core delicate scent lasting for hours. And when everything else seems to have been blown away the base note ceases to go away.
Blended Fragrance that Never Ends
As much as you like varying mix of drinks, fragrances also come in different blends. This paved way for the differentiation of Perfume, Eau de Parfum, and Eau de Toilette. Perfume remains to be the forerunner of fragrances with up to 30% concentration of essences that normally lasts for six hours though saturation may cause irritation. Eau de Parfum comes next in the hierarchy with up to 15% concentration of pure juice scents hence lighter and milder lasting for up to five hours. Finally, Eau de Toilette has the least juice concentration of up to 4% which stays for 4 hours, at the most.
Premier Houses of Fragrance
The House of Armani features a distinctive collection of fragrances. It was by Giorgio Armani who is an Italian fashion designer of men’s wear since 1975 and launched his line of fragrances thereafter in 1991. One of its prominent scents is the Acqua Di Gio renowned for its invigorating ambiance fresh from the Mediterranean breeze made available for men and women, alike.
The House of Dior is another prominent perfumer since 1947. It was established by Christian Dior upon introduction of Miss Dior in the mid-20th century. Hypnotic poison is one of its priced perfume lines featuring the grace and power of a woman which is equally distinctive as the J’Adore perfume line taking pride of feminine class and sensuality at its finest.
The House of Miyake hailing from Asia offers an Oriental approach to fragrances. It was instituted by Issey Miyake, a Japanese fashion designer who ventured out in fragrances in 1992 with L’eau d’Issey that highlights aquatic floral scent. The classic scent is specially formulated with citrus and spice meticulously blended with amber, musk, and wood available both for ladies and gentlemen.
